emptiness
emp-ti-ness · noun
Definitions
noun
- 1.
The state of containing nothing; the quality of being empty.
- 2.
A feeling of loneliness, sadness, or lack of purpose.
- 3.
(In philosophy or spirituality) The absence of inherent existence or self-nature.

Etymology
From empty + -ness, from Old English ǣmtig ("at leisure, not occupied").
